Shareholders Approve Significant Equity Plan Expansion and Further Dilutive Issuances
summarizeSummary
Reliance Global Group shareholders approved a substantial increase of 14 million shares to its equity incentive plan and authorized additional share issuances under an existing purchase agreement, enabling significant future dilution.

Equity Incentive Plan Expanded
Shareholders approved an amendment to the 2025 Equity Incentive Plan, increasing the number of shares available for issuance by 14,000,000, from 2,000,000 to 16,000,000 shares. If all these shares were issued, dilution would be approximately 66% based on current outstanding shares.
-
Authorization for Dilutive Issuances
Approval was granted for the issuance of common stock in excess of the Nasdaq Exchange Cap, pursuant to a Common Stock Purchase Agreement dated August 26, 2025, enabling further capital raises without additional shareholder approval for exceeding the cap.
-
Director Elections and Auditor Ratification
Five director nominees were elected to serve until the 2027 Annual Meeting, and Urish Popeck & Co., LLC was ratified as the independ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2026.

The approval of Proposal 3, which adds 14 million shares to the 2025 Equity Incentive Plan, represents a potential dilution of approximately 66% relative to the current outstanding shares. This substantial increase in available shares for compensation or future grants could significantly impact per-share value. Furthermore, Proposal 4's approval to issue shares beyond the Nasdaq Exchange Cap under an existing purchase agreement removes a key hurdle for the company to raise additional capital, likely through further dilutive offerings. For a micro-cap company like Reliance Global Group, these approvals signal a high likelihood of substantial future dilution, which could pressure the stock price.
At the time of this filing, EZRA was trading at $0.18 on NASDAQ in the Finance sector, with a market capitalization of approximately $3.7M. The 52-week trading range was $0.15 to $3.55. This filing was assessed with negative market sentiment and an importance score of 9 out of 10.
